Exercise 6.7
A sailor jumps out from a small boat to the shore (Fig. ). As the sailor jumps forward, will the boat move? If yes, in which direction and why.

Yes, the boat moves — backwards, i.e. away from the shore, opposite to the sailor's jump.
To jump forward the sailor's feet push backwards on the boat.
By Newton's third law, the boat simultaneously pushes the sailor forward with an equal and opposite force, which is what launches him towards the shore.
The two forces of this pair act on different objects — one on the boat, one on the sailor — so they do not cancel each other.
The backward force on the boat is a net force on it (water offers little resistance), so by \(\displaystyle F = ma \) the boat accelerates backwards.
Because the boat is small, its mass is not very large, so the backward push gives it a noticeable acceleration — which is why jumping from a small boat is tricky.
